How to Install a Cookie Run Shimeji

Step 1: Download the Shimeji Java file (.jar)
- Search for “Cookie Run Shimeji download” on platforms like DeviantArt, GitHub, or Pixiv (use
しめじas a Japanese keyword). - Look for a user who has packaged a specific cookie (e.g., “Pure Vanilla Shimeji”).
Step 2: Ensure Java is installed
- Shimeji requires Java Runtime Environment (JRE) . Download it for free from the official Java website.
Step 3: Run the .jar file
- Double-click the file. A small icon will appear in your system tray (Windows) or menu bar (Mac).
- Note for Mac users: You may need to right-click → “Open” to bypass Gatekeeper.
Step 4: Set the behavior
- Right-click the tray icon. You can toggle:
- Move (the cookie roams)
- Copy (clones the cookie)
- Disperse (sends them all away)
